A PARTY has been held to thank all those who helped to stage last year’s Grand Henham Steam Rally.

More than 60 people gathered at the Plough Inn, in Wangford, as chairman of the organising committee Mike Powell-Evans presented cheques of more than £30,000 to the main charities that supported by the rally.

Wangford and District Community Council, Southwold (Sole Bay) Lions Club and the Parochial Church Councils of Sotherton, Wangford cum Henham and Uggeshall all benefited, while a donation was also give to Macmillan Cancer Support.

Mr Powell-Evans also made presentations to Geoff Purkiss, Robin Chater, and Mike Steven-Jones who have retired from the organising committe, while he reported that plans are well underway for this year’s event.

The 37th Grand Henham Steam Rally will be held at Henham Park, off the A12 between Southwold and Beccles, on September 15 and 16.
